# Break-Glass: Catalog Cache Invalidation

Scope: the Pinrow product catalog at Veldstone Retail. If stale prices persist after a purge and the Hollowmere invalidation queue is wedged, use break-glass to flush the edge tier directly. Contractors: get verbal sign-off from the catalog lead first. Steps: open the Hollowmere admin shell, select emergency-flush, confirm the tenant, and run it once — repeated flushes thrash the origin. Access is logged and expires after 20 minutes. Unseal the admin shell with the passphrase below.

recovery phrase for kahop-tajog: istix-casvan

Subject: Quickstore 4.2 — bloom filter now fronts the KV layer

Plugin authors: starting with this release, Quickstore places a bloom filter ahead of the key-value store. Negative lookups return faster; false positives fall through safely. No API changes are required on your side. Verify your plugin against the staging build referenced below.

session token of fahif-tadup = htk3_9c7

## GC Pauses in Matchwell

The Matchwell matching service occasionally exhibits garbage-collection pauses exceeding 800ms, which can trip the upstream timeout and page you. Before restarting anything, capture a heap snapshot and check whether the pause coincided with the hourly index rebuild, the usual culprit. Detailed tuning history and the approved mitigation steps are recorded on the internal page.

dashboard of kafof-tahaf = https://confluence.tolvaqsys.internal/projects/browse/display/a1250987